rhg: add support for detailed exit code for ConfigParseError This patch adds basic support for detailed exit code to rhg with support for ConfigParseError. For now, if parsing the config results in error, we silently fallbacks to `false`. The python version in this case emits a traceback. Differential Revision: https://phab.mercurial-scm.org/D10253
